What a difference a year makes.

It was only last June that Seattle Mayor Jenny Durkan was drawing national ridicule after suggesting that allowing a segment of her city’s downtown to devolve into lawlessness could be paving the way for a “summer of love.” (It didn’t.)

Thirteen months later, and eight months after she signed a city budget that slashed police funding by almost 20 percent, Durkan is singing a different tune — but she isn’t getting a lot of sympathy.

In a news conference Monday, the liberal Democrat who has already announced she’s not running for re-election said the Emerald City is going to have to rebuild its police force.

“As a city, we cannot continue on this current trajectory of losing police officers,” she said, according to Fox News. “Over the past 17 months, the Seattle Police Department has lost 250 police officers which is the equivalent of over 300,000 service hours. We’re on path to losing 300 police officers.”

The news conference followed a weekend where Seattle saw five people killed in separate shootings, according to KCPQ-TV.

That’s coming in a year where, according to KOMO-TV, the total number of shootings in King County — where Seattle is the county seat — was already running 33 percent higher this year than the four-year average for 2017-2020.

Shooting deaths this year are 48 percent higher than the four-year average, KOMO reported.
